A breakthrough in photo-based AI could give Alaska wildlife managers better data without putting hands on the animals.
Updated: 17 minutes agoA female brown bear at the McNeil River State Game Sanctuary on the Alaska Peninsula. Time and again, colleagues told bear biologist Beth Rosenberg that her quest to develop a new and less invasive way“It just won’t work,” she heard repeatedly.
Inspired by her hero, the acclaimed primatologist Jane Goodall, Rosenberg stubbornly pushed ahead, just as Goodall had done decades earlier in the face of great skepticism.brown bear sanctuary, Rosenberg had quickly learned that by paying close attention, she, like others on the sanctuary staff, could over time identify the “regulars” who fished at McNeil Falls, especially mature males. It’s true the sample size was small.
But if people could learn to recognize individual bears among the dozens that pass through McNeil River each summer — and do so repeatedly, despite dramatic changes in their seasonal appearance — wouldn’t it be possible to do the same thing at greater scale, using new, state-of-the-art technologies? Rosenberg began to build a photo database of McNeil’s most recognizable bears, as others on staff had done before her.
And when promoted to assistant manager in 2016, she made expanding that database a priority. Over the next several years, she enlarged it to nearly 73,000 images, representing 109 individual bears. — and an enthusiastic supporter of her work — Rosenberg then went looking for computer and technology whizzes who could assist in this quest. The two eventually found such a group at the École Polytechnique Fédérale de Lausanne in Switzerland, led by Alexander Mathis.
One of the keys to clinching the partnership was Rosenberg’s immense file of bear images, which Wolf — eventually her research colleague as well as mentor — describes as “a data set that’s unique in the world; there’s nothing else like it. ” Another key was Mathis and Rosenberg’s shared excitement about the possibilities their collaboration might open up.
Combining their expertise, a team composed of Alaska biologists and Swiss computer scientists was able to develop an artificial intelligence — or as Rosenberg prefers to say, “deep learning” — system that they call“Trained” on the data set of nearly 73,000 McNeil River images, PoseSwin has proved capable of recognizing individual bears across seasons — and even years — despite major changes in the animals’ body size, fur condition and position, and seasonal and environmental variations, such as light and weather conditions. Importantly, the researchers emphasize, their work demonstrates it’s possible to accurately — and repeatedly — identify individual bears across space and time using photographs alone, what Rosenberg calls “photo ID.
” This means there’s no need to physically handle and mark the animals, for instance with collars or tags, or to retrieve fur or blood samples, as routinely done in conventional population studies and other research. That in turn opens all sorts of new possibilities for the study, management and conservation of brown bears — and other species — in Alaska and beyond.
Adding greatly to the credibility of their work, the Alaska-Swiss team produced an article describing their research and findings: “Individual identification of brown bears using pose-aware metric learning” was published in the February 2026 issue of the prestigious, peer-reviewed scientific journalWhile it’s not possible to get into the details of their work in a commentary of this length, the bottom line, say Rosenberg and Wolf, is that the low-impact, “hands-off” PoseSwin/photo ID program promises to revolutionize the way bears are studied and understood by “adding a new tool to our toolbox,” as Wolf puts it. And a greatly advanced tool at that.
The Alaska-Swiss team plans to keep expanding its data set and refining its PoseSwin program. All of this will lead to an increased understanding of bears’ individual and collective behavior and interactions with each other and other species, including — and especially — humans. That knowledge in turn promises to lead to more informed, fact-based management of both the animals and the habitat that is essential to their well-being, which can only benefit their conservation.
Here I’ll leave the science arena and move into an area where Rosenberg, Wolf and the rest of the PoseSwin team prefer not to tread: wildlife politics.that many wildlife advocates, including myself, regard as suspect. That’s not so much because the research methods are faulty, but rather because the information is outdated and/or withheld from the public. This is especially true for predators such as bears and wolves and “intensive management” programs intended to “control” their numbers.
The recent — and ongoing — Mulchatna bear kill program in Southwest Alaska is a prime example. Over the past three years, Fish and Game has killed close to 200 bears, the great majority of them brown bears, ostensibly to help the Mulchatna Caribou Herd recover from a steep decline that Fish and Game’s own biologists have shown has nothing to do with bear predation, without any good idea of the region’s overall bear population.
This is a major reason two Superior Court judges ordered the department to stop its Mulchatna bear kill effort in 2025. Fish and Game managers continue to insist that their intensive management and predator control programs are based on “good science,” but remain unwilling to share the specifics of what that science shows or how it’s been done.
An Alaska Superior Court judgeto resume shooting bears in Southwest Alaska this spring to boost the caribou herd, a plan moving forward despite a lack of comprehensive population data. It may be asking too much for Fish and Game’s current wildlife managers to welcome, let alone embrace, the revolutionary research methods promised by PoseSwin and photo ID.
